How to Improve Touch Accuracy of Touch Screens in Industrial Environments with Dust and Oil Contamination?1.The surface is coated with nano oil-proof and dust-resistant film. It repels oil and prevents dust accumulation. Grease and cutting fluid can be wiped off effortlessly, avoiding contaminants from seeping into and disrupting the sensing layer. Meanwhile, it features excellent scrub resistance and chemical corrosion resistance, compatible with detergents used in chemical and food industries.
2.The panel material is upgraded to tempered glass with G+G structure, replacing conventional film screens. The dense and smooth glass surface has far lower adhesion to dust and grease, so contaminants will not get trapped in gaps easily.
3.It achieves IP65 and above dustproof and waterproof rating. Sealing gaskets are installed on joints and edges to block cutting fluid mist and dust from invading internal circuits and sensing layers through gaps.
4.Equipped with oil stain false touch suppression algorithm. It identifies false touch signals caused by large-area liquid grease and heavy dust coverage, automatically shields invalid touch points to prevent random cursor jumps and unintended activations.
5.Features adaptive sensitivity adjustment. For working conditions with accumulated dust and thin oil films, the algorithm dynamically raises the touch recognition threshold to filter weak interference signals. It responds normally to human touch, balancing anti-false touch performance and operating sensitivity.
6.Blocks interference signals generated by dust and oil residue on panel edges, maintaining stable touch performance in the central area.
How to Improve Impact Resistance?1.Adopt thickened tempered glass with secondary strengthening treatment to boost impact resistance and bending resistance. The edges are precisely ground and chamfered to eliminate stress concentration, preventing chipping and cracking from collisions.
2.
A highly elastic silicone buffer frame is installed around the screen to absorb impact and vibration, isolating external forces from directly acting on the glass panel.
3.The flexible cables adopt snap-in sockets combined with hot-melt adhesive for fixation. Cables are routed with a proper curvature to avoid tension and sharp bends, effectively preventing loosening and disconnection under vibration.
4.Critical components such as main chips, resistors and capacitors are secured with reinforced soldering and glue dispensing protection, eliminating poor solder joints and component falling off under vibration.
5.High-density shockproof foam and damping pads are fitted between the module back, mainboard and housing to reduce high-frequency vibration transmission and mitigate resonance impact.
